Issue Summary

Citibank has been sued by a $20 million victim of a cryptocurrency romance scam, who claims the bank "failed to detect any clearly suspicious transactions" when they transferred millions of dollars to the bank. This incident is sparking controversy regarding not only financial losses in the cryptocurrency market but also the safety and transaction monitoring systems of banks. Amid concerns that such cases may occur more frequently, the importance of financial institutions monitoring digital asset transactions is being highlighted.

Technical Summary

This incident brings the issue of the anonymity and irreversibility of cryptocurrency transactions to the forefront once again. While blockchain technology transparently records transaction history, it is difficult to track the identity of the actual user. Therefore, this demonstrates the greater need for technical measures that allow banks and financial institutions to monitor these transactions and rapidly identify suspicious activity.
